Plan In Advance, Connect With Stakeholders

Today, there are a number of sporting event coordination tools available. Regardless of these tools, your active involvement in the planning ensures the success of the event. You should also connect with team managements, local administration, local community, utility providers, and more to make the event seamless.

Have you ensured that the event is in accordance with the local rules and regulations? Get the approvals in advance to avoid the last-minute hassles that can divert your attention from the purpose of the event. 

You should also make sure the event is insured for liability to safeguard from any unforeseen issues. These days, many event organizers prefer to insure the prize giveaways as well.

Your initial plan should have all these details, and you don’t forget to include timelines for completing various tasks. You can review the plan after a while to include anything that you missed in the initial plan.

Create Your Team

While laying out the plans, you shouldn’t forget to create a team to ensure things work around you. Form a group of trusted people to individually work on each task and checklist you have created to make the event success. Remember, they should be equally committed like you to ensure the success of the event.

You can assign them various responsibilities according to their expertise and skillsets. Some of them may have leadership skills, and you can utilize them for executing tasks that need to manage a group of people.

It is important to set the expectations, communicate those to the team, and regularly review the progress. You can also try to make a personal relationship with the team to understand their strengths and weaknesses to have better control over the event execution.

Find Sponsors For The Event

Getting a local authority or business on board as a sponsor is also critical in making your event smooth and successful. It’s not your way to meet some of the costs associated with the event but the option to connect with the local community and people as well.

The mutually beneficial relationship will help you to get low-cost event staff or volunteers to make the event hassle-free. It can also help you to get increased promotion as well as participation for the event. Businesses, from small shops to global corporations, use sports events to position and build their brands.

Reach Out To The Audience

The enthusiasts of the sports event may show up even if you don’t connect with them. But you can sit with and relax as just fans won’t make the event a great success. Reach out to everyone in the locality and engage them to bring them in. It is vital to create connectivity with the local community through advertising campaigns, shows, and programs.

Create a theme with stunning visuals, song, and message to enthrall visitors. Advertise in local media and utilize social media platforms to connect with maximum people. Interestingly, social media is an excellent choice to monitor the response of people even days before the event.

Never forget to leverage technology to connect with people. Conduct quiz programs, result predictions, and more to involve people and to leverage word of mouth.
